Job Overview
  • Partner with the Divisional Commercial Director to manage all commercial elements of high‑value remediation / recladding projects across London.
  • Administer project contractual requirements, including Applications for Payment, Contractual Notices, Variations and Loss & Expense claims.
  • Maintain and manage accurate project records.
  • Produce monthly financial reports:
    Cost Value Reconciliation (CVR), risk & opportunity registers, ISV forecasting.
  • Lead the procurement process:']: prepare procurement plans, engage the project team, conduct tenders, analyze supplier quotations and place project package orders.
  • Administer supplier contracts, agree payments, variations, claims and manage final accounts.
  • Ensure final account agreement with clients.
  • Operate in a high‑energy, professional and fast‑paced environment, working closely with both office and site teams.
  • Drive improvements to commercial performance, support business growth and deliver projects "right first time".
